WebApr 11, 2024 · (1) The first phase of diabetes insipidus is initiated by a partial or complete pituitary stalk section, which severs the connections between the cell bodies of AVP … WebA triphasic response may occur after pituitary surgery due to damage to the hypothalamus and supraopticohypophyseal tract ( 6. , 7. , 8. ). The typical sequence of abnormalities in this triphasic response are development of diabetes insipidus shortly after surgery, followed by SIADH and then, finally, permanent diabetes insipidus.
